Wheat Grass

1. Rich in nutrients
Wheatgrass contains vitamins A, C, E, and K, along with iron, magnesium, calcium, and some amino acids. Because it’s concentrated, a small shot gives a decent micronutrient boost, especially if someone’s diet lacks greens.
2. Supports digestion
Some people notice better digestion and less bloating. The chlorophyll and enzymes may help gut function, though it’s not a cure for digestive diseases.
3. May help energy levels
Not in the way caffeine does. It doesn’t stimulate the nervous system. Energy improvement usually comes from better nutrition and hydration rather than a direct “energy boost.”
4. Antioxidant support
Wheatgrass contains antioxidants that help reduce oxidative stress in the body. This is more about long-term health support than immediate effects.
5. Blood health support
Because of its iron and chlorophyll content, it’s sometimes used by people trying to improve hemoglobin levels, but it should not replace medical treatment for anemia.
6. May support detox processes
The liver and kidneys already detox the body. Wheatgrass can support overall nutrition, but it doesn’t “clean toxins” in a literal sense.

✅ How to take it
Fresh juice: 20–30 ml in the morning on an empty stomach
Powder: about 1 teaspoon in water or juice
Start small because it can cause nausea in some people initially
